Drug treatment services for the hearing impaired are available in both an inpatient and outpatient basis. Individuals with a hearing impairment may be at a greater risk of addiction disorders because of their handicap. Having a significant disability can be a root cause for discouragement, depression, unhappiness and apathy for both adolescents and adults who could easily turn to alcohol or drugs to cope with these emotions. Hearing impaired services are offered in Parksville to stop the cycle of addiction for these clients, with ASL and other assistance which offers recovery and treatment information and education in writing so that clients aren't inhibited from recovering because of their impairment.

Drug and alcohol treatment centers with full time staff to assist the hearing impaired are the most appropriate programs to consider. Some facilities may only have part-time staff to assist and interpret hearing impaired clients, and this means hearing impaired clients won't benefit as much as everyone else and will miss out on essential activities they should be involved with daily. There could be video presentations available which use sign language as well, which can also be extremely helpful.

There are organizations and agencies that can give hearing impaired people struggling with substance abuse issues with information and resources to find the rehabilitation services they need. One of these is the Deaf Off Drugs and Alcohol (DODA).
